Chocolate Angel Food Cake with Berries

Angel food cake rises to new heights with this chocolate-rich recipe. For an added treat, drizzle with melted chocolate or caramel sauce.

1 cup unbleached all-purpose flour
1 cup sugar
1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
10 egg whites, at room temperature
1 1/4 teaspoons cream of tartar
1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la extract
2 cups assorted fresh berries
confectioners' sugar


Directions

1. Preheat the oven to 350°F.

2. Sift the flour, 1/2 cup of the sugar, cocoa, and cinnamon into a medium bowl.

3. Place the egg whites in a large bowl. With an electric mixer on medium speed, beat until foamy. Add the cream of tartar and beat until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in the remaining 1/2 cup sugar and vanilla extract. Continue beating until stiff peaks form.

4. Fold in the flour mixture 1 cup at a time, just until blended Place in a 10" tube pan, spreading evenly and deflating any large air pockets with a knife.

5. Bake for 40 minutes, or until a wooden pick inserted in the center comes out clean. Cool upside down on a bottle neck for 40 minutes. Turn right side up and run a knife around the rim of the cake to loosen it from the sides. Remove the cake from the pan and place on a rack to cool completely.

6. To serve, top the cake with the berries and sprinkle with confectioners' sugar.

Nutritional Facts per serving

Calories 136.8
Fat 0.5 G
Saturate Fat 0.2 G
Cholesterol 0 MG
Sodium 47.2 MG
Carbohydrates 29.1 G
Total Sugars 18.7 G
Dietary Fiber 1.8 G
Protein 4.8 G
